Default The best way to report

Ok, im a rules lawyer of sorts on red. So I got what people seem to call Petitionquest syndrome.

I'm looking for the best way to petition, to both make it easier on me and on the GM's.

Screenshots - when I upload them to my album their always too small....

Logs - How do you make it so the log always turns on automaticly when you log in?

Videos - I use fraps (way too much memory) the I reformat the videos to something smaller then upload then to you tube....problem is the text chat which is so important gets lost on the way, (the red in pitcualar) is there a way to set up my screen so that the texts and UI is clear enough to see whats going on? is there a better way to capture video? what format should I use? how should I upload it? ete

Any other suggestions?

Under the [Defaults] section of eqclient.ini you want to ensure you have a line saying 'Log=true'.
(delete Log=False if it is there).

Save screen shots as .PNG to imgur. Not jpeg or BMP.

You can upload raw fraps to YouTube or vimeo. It will just take a long time depending on connection speed. You can also increase font size of chat windows.

2 real ways to get staff to take your report seriously...
Live stream to twitch and link the staff a highlight from your video
Record video of decent quality, compress it and upload it to a file hosting site. Attach the link for that and a virus total for it.

Youtube ruins your video quality, I'm not sure about vimeo quality but i do know they have some rules about posting content that is not yours..

Anyone can edit a log file or a screenshot. Sure the staff could dig through the server log for your situation but damn that'd be a pain for them. Always include unqiue keywords when you talk in game (LOL)
